Abstract

A bending machine includes hydraulic cylinders capable of adjusting an inclination state, eccentric shaft units, and a control device. The control device sets an inclination state of the upper table and also sets a curved state of the lower table to conform to the inclination state of the upper table in order to carry out partial bending to pressurize a limited pressurized range compared to a pressurized range in which a workpiece is pressurized by using entire areas of an upper tool and a lower tool in a lateral direction. The control device changes a combination of the inclination state of the upper table and the curved state of the lower table and repeats the partial bending while causing a transition of the limited pressurized range in order to carry out entire area bending to pressurize the workpiece over an entire area in the lateral direction.

Claims

exact text as granted — not AI-modified
1 . A bending machine including a movable table to which a first tool is attached along a lateral direction, and a fixed table arranged to be opposed to the movable table in a vertical direction and to which a second tool is attached along the lateral direction, the movable table being moved in the vertical direction to pressurize a workpiece between the first tool and the second tool in order to carry out bending of the workpiece, the bending machine comprising:
 an elevating mechanism configured to move the movable table in the vertical direction and capable of adjusting an inclination state showing an inclination to left and right of the movable table;   a crowning mechanism configured to curve a part of the fixed table; and   a control device configured to control the elevating mechanism and the crowning mechanism, wherein   the control device sets the inclination state of the movable table and also sets a curved state of the fixed table to conform to the inclination state of the movable table in order in order to carry out partial bending to pressurize a limited pressurized range compared to a pressurized range in which the workpiece is pressurized by using entire areas of the first tool and the second tool in the lateral direction, and   the control device changes a combination of the inclination state of the movable table and the curved state of the fixed table and repeats the partial bending while causing a transition of the limited pressurized range in order to carry out entire area bending to pressurize the workpiece over an entire area in the lateral direction.   
     
     
         2 . The bending machine according to  claim 1 , wherein the control device repeats the entire area bending a plurality of times to bend the workpiece step by step to a target bending angle. 
     
     
         3 . The bending machine according to  claim 1 , wherein
 the elevating mechanism can move the movable table in a range from a top dead center at which the movable table is separated from the fixed table by a predetermined distance to a bottom dead center at which the movable table comes closest to the fixed table, and   the control device sets the inclination state of the movable table before the movable table reaches the bottom dead center when the partial bending is carried out.   
     
     
         4 . The bending machine according to  claim 3 , wherein, after the partial bending, the control device moves the movable table toward the top dead center within a range in which the first tool and the workpiece are in contact with each other by spring back of the workpiece, and then changes a combination of the inclination state of the movable table and the curved state of the fixed table. 
     
     
         5 . The bending machine according to  claim 4 , wherein the control device moves the movable table toward the top dead center while maintaining the inclination state thereof when the workpiece is pressurized in the limited pressurized range. 
     
     
         6 . The bending machine according to  claim 1 , wherein the control device curves a left side of the fixed table upward when the movable table is in an inclination state in which a left side of the movable table is closer to the fixed table than a right side of the movable table. 
     
     
         7 . The bending machine according to  claim 1 , wherein the control device curves a right side of the fixed table upward when the movable table is in an inclination state in which a right side of the movable table is closer to the fixed table than a left side of the movable table. 
     
     
         8 . The bending machine according to  claim 1 , wherein the control device curves a center of the fixed table upward when the movable table is in an inclination state in which the left and right of the movable table is horizontal. 
     
     
         9 . The bending machine according to  claim 1 , wherein
 the elevating mechanism includes left and right elevating units provided at left and right ends of the movable table and capable of being controlled independently of each other, and   the crowning mechanism includes left and right crowning units provided symmetrically with respect to a center position of the fixed table in the lateral direction and capable of being controlled independently of each other.   
     
     
         10 . The bending machine according to  claim 9 , wherein when the workpiece is pressurized after being divided into three pressurized ranges of a left side, a center, and a right side, the control device corrects outputs of the left and right elevating units and outputs of the left and right crowning units based on bending angles obtained at four angle measurement points positioned at boundaries of the respective pressurized ranges. 
     
     
         11 . A bending machine including a movable table to which a first tool is attached along a lateral direction, and a fixed table arranged to be opposed to the movable table in a vertical direction and to which a second tool is attached along the lateral direction, the movable table being moved in the vertical direction to pressurize a workpiece between the first tool and the second tool in order to carry out bending of the workpiece, the bending machine comprising:
 an elevating mechanism configured to move the movable table in the vertical direction;   an inclination mechanism capable of adjusting an inclination state showing an inclination to left and right of the fixed table;   a crowning mechanism configured to curve a part of the movable table; and   a control device configured to control the elevating mechanism, the inclination mechanism, and the crowning mechanism, wherein   the control device sets the inclination state of the fixed table and also sets a curved state of the movable table to conform to the inclination state of the fixed table in order to carry out partial bending to pressurize a limited pressurized range compared to a pressurized range when the workpiece is pressurized by using entire areas of the first tool and the second tool in the lateral direction, and   the control device changes a combination of the inclination state of the fixed table and the curved state of the movable table and repeats the partial bending while causing a transition of the limited pressurized range in order to carry out entire area bending to pressurize the workpiece over an entire area in the lateral direction.   
     
     
         12 . A bending method of carrying out bending of a workpiece in which a bending machine including a movable table to which a first tool is attached along a lateral direction and a fixed table arranged to be opposed to the movable table in a vertical direction and to which a second tool is attached along the lateral direction, carries out bending of a workpiece by moving the movable table in the vertical direction to pressurize the workpiece between the first tool and the second tool, the bending method comprising:
 setting an inclination state of the movable table; setting a curved state of the fixed table so as to conform to the inclination state of the movable table;   carrying out partial bending to pressurize a limited pressurized range compared to a pressurized range when the workpiece is pressurized by using entire areas of the first tool and the second tool in the lateral direction; and   carrying out entire area bending to pressurize the workpiece over an entire area in the lateral direction by changing a combination of the inclination state of the movable table and the curved state of the fixed table and repeating the partial bending while causing a transition of the limited pressurized range.
